It looks tactile because it still had some practical effects. Had it been done now it would be mostly if not all CGI. And I don't hate CGI. But the reason some older movies look better with less advanced technology is because they had to be deliberate with how they used it. Nowadays it's the opposite. Directors lean on CGI as a crutch. They don't bother planning like they used to because they will "just fix it in post".

You can speed up your InDesign workflow by setting master pages and using Data Merge. Though I think InDesign would be more for final artwork. For faster prototyping a lot of people are suggesting nanDeck.

It's sounds like you have a thing for intelligent people coming up with plans and strategies and executing them. Might I suggest "The Devil's Plan" on Netflix. It's probably not what you're expecting, a Korean reality/game show where they gather a dozen or so high IQ people (poker players, Go players, Mensa members, plus some celebrities) and pit them against each other in high pressure games until there is one winner. The games are like high stakes board games, usually with some element of deception or incentivised betrayal. If you're a fan of strategy, board games, game theory or psychology I think you'll be into it.

imo, the OG 'The Genius' was a better show, it had 4 seasons and I highly recommend it.
